Sunderland 0:0 Queens Park Rangers

For Queens Park Rangers, it was the first game under Harry Redknapp. During the week, Redknapp underlined the importance of the player’s work ethic and said: “If people aren’t willing to work hard, they have no part to play. If they lose the ball, they should chase it, work, run about.” Sunderland on the other side, wanted to move away from the relegation spots. Manager Martin O’Neill was under huge pressure this week with rumours about his departure.

However, QPR showed a much improved performance straight from the beginning and Cisse had 3 major chances to score the lead in the first half, but both were saved by Sunderland keeper Simon Mignolet. Sunderland, however, created there chances through Adam Johnson in the first half who wasn’t able to finish against Cesar. Stephane Mbia almost scored for QPR in the second half after a 25-yard drive. However, the game finished 0:0.

Harry Redknapp seemed relieved and impressed about his first game and admitted that “they [QPR] worked there socks off.” Especially his midfield is one that “you wouldn’t like to play against“.

Nevertheless, QPR remains bottom of the table with only 5 points. QPR is only the 9th team in the history of the Premier League that couldn’t win any of their first 14 games, however, QPR ended a run of 23 games without a clean sheet.
